Specifications of Xiaomi Poco F7 Pro
The display of Xiaomi Poco F7 Pro measures 6.67 inches with AMOLED technology and 120Hz refresh rate. Peak brightness reaches 1800 nits for excellent outdoor visibility. The screen renders at 1440x3200 pixels resolution.
The camera system of Xiaomi Poco F7 Pro features 3 rear cameras: 50 main, 8MP ultrawide, 12MP telephoto. Optical zoom reaches 3x for detailed distant shots. Video recording supports up to 4320p.
The battery of Xiaomi Poco F7 Pro has 6000mAh capacity with 90 wired charging. Wireless charging supports 50. A full charge takes approximately 37 min minutes.
The performance of Xiaomi Poco F7 Pro is powered by the Snapdragon 8 chipset with Adreno 750 GPU. AnTuTu benchmark achieves 2065265.
The memory of Xiaomi Poco F7 Pro offers 12GB RAM with 256GB storage options. RAM uses LPDDR5X technology. Storage is 256GB 12GB RAM, 512GB 12GB RAM. Storage is not expandable.
The connectivity of Xiaomi Poco F7 Pro includes 5G support, Wi-Fi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ac/6e/7, and Bluetooth 5.4. NFC is supported for contactless payments.
The build of Xiaomi Poco F7 Pro weighs 206.0g with Aluminum frame and Glass back. Water and dust resistance is rated IP68. Dimensions measure 160.3 x 75 x 8.1 mm.
The software of Xiaomi Poco F7 Pro runs Android 15, HyperOS 2 with HyperOS. Software support extends 4 years through 2030.
